0
웹 서버가받는 모든 요청을 추적하는 로깅 시스템을 만들고 있습니다. 요청에 파일, 즉 파일 업로드 동작이 포함되어 있는지 확인하려면 어떻게해야합니까?레일스 요청 매개 변수에 파일 필드가 있는지 확인하는 방법
웹 서버가받는 모든 요청을 추적하는 로깅 시스템을 만들고 있습니다. 요청에 파일, 즉 파일 업로드 동작이 포함되어 있는지 확인하려면 어떻게해야합니까?레일스 요청 매개 변수에 파일 필드가 있는지 확인하는 방법
요청하신 MIME 유형을 확인하십시오. 그 :multipart_form
을 반환하는 경우
request.content_mime_type.symbol
=> :multipart_form
당신은 params
값을 통해 이동 ActionDispatch::Http::UploadedFile
의 종류를 검색 할 수 있습니다.
당신의 방법은 목적을 해결하지만 각 매개 변수, 즉 중첩 된 매개 변수를 통과하는 것은 너무 많은 오버 헤드 일 것이고 매개 변수에 중첩 수준이 높은 경우에는 실현 불가능할 것입니다. –